A:link {color:#0000ff; text-decoration:underline; font-weight:normal; background-color:inherit }
A:hover {color:#000000; text-decoration:underline; font-weight:normal; background-color:inherit }
A:visited {color:#0000ff; text-decoration:underline; font-weight:normal; background-color:inherit }

body { 	
	background-color: #ff6f1a;  /* change also in cgi error output */
	margin:0;
	padding:0;
	font-family: Verdana,Arial,Sans-serif,helvetica;
}
form { margin: 0px; } 
.bgTone {	background-color: #FFFFEE; } /*cgi*/

.mainTable {
	width:100%; height:101%;     /*show scrollbar even if page empty*/
}

.mastImg {
	border-left:1px solid #ff0000;
	border-right:1px solid #ff0000;
}

.cellMast {
	border-top:1px solid #005500;
	border-bottom:1px solid orange;
}
.cellNav {
	height:22px;
	background-color:#005500;
	border-bottom:1px solid #ffffff;
}
.cellContent {
	width:785px;
	height:100%;
}

#hDiv {
	width:100%;
	height:160px;
	position:absolute;
	top:44px;
	left:0px;
}
.hDivStyle {
	border-top:3px solid #ffffff;
	border-bottom:3px solid #ffffff;
}
/*
TD {
	FONT-SIZE: 12px; COLOR: #003300;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
}
*/

.capTop {
	 background:url(grafx/curvCap.gif) no-repeat center top;	
}
.capBot {
	 background:url(grafx/curvCap.gif) no-repeat center bottom;	
}

.bb1 { background-color:#004400; color:#ffffff; font-family:Verdana,Arial,Sans-serif,helvetica; font-size:10px; font-weight:bold; height:17px; 
	border: 1px solid #cccccc;
}
.bb2 { background:#ffffff; color:#094863; font-family:Verdana,Arial,Sans-serif,helvetica; font-size:10px; font-weight:bold; height:17px;
	border:1px solid #001100;
}
.bb3 { background-color:#f4f4f4; color:#ff0000; font-family:Verdana,Arial,Sans-serif,helvetica; font-size:10px; font-weight:bold; height:17px; 
	border: 1px solid #ff00ff; 
	border-top: 1px solid #dddddd; 
	border-bottom: 1px solid #ffffff; 
}
.bbWait { background-color:#660000; color:#dddddd; font-family:Verdana,Arial,Sans-serif,helvetica; font-size:10px; font-weight:bold; height:17px; 
	border: 1px solid #ff0000; 
}
.bbMess  {background:url(grafx/a-pixi.gif); color:#ff0000; font-family:Verdana,Arial,Sans-serif,helvetica; font-size:11px; font-weight:bold; height:18px; border-width:0px; text-align:center; cursor:default; }

.dpDwn { background-color:#fffff8; color:#660000; height:17px; font-size:10px; font-family:verdana,arial,Sans-serif,helvetica; border:solid 1px #660000; }
.txFld { background-color:#fffff8; color:#000000; height:17px; font-size:11px; font-family:Verdana,Arial,Sans-serif,helvetica; font-weight:normal; border:solid 1px #660000; padding-left:3px;}

.redMed {
	font-size: 11px;
	color: #ff0000;
}
.blkSml {
	font-size: 10px;
	color: #000000;
}
.blkMed {
	font-size: 11px;
	color: #000000;
}
.blkLrg {
	font-size: 12px;
	color: #000000;
}

.brnSml {
	font-size: 10px;
	color: #880000;
}
.brnMed {
	font-size: 11px;
	color: #880000;
}
.brnLrg {
	font-size: 12px;
	color: #880000;
}
.grnSml {
	font-size: 10px;
	color: #003300;
}
.grnMed {
	font-size: 11px;
	color: #003300;
}
.grnLrg {
	font-size: 12px;
	color: #003300;
}
.whiSml {
	font-size: 10px;
	color: #f0f0f0;
}
.whiMed {
	font-size: 11px;
	color: #f0f0f0;
}
.whiLrg {
	font-size: 12px;
	color: #f0f0f0;
}
.tagline {
	/*border-top:2px solid #ffffff;*/
	font-size: 10px;
	color: #ffffff;
}
.grySml {
	font-size: 10px;
	color: #999999;
}
.goldSml {
	font-size: 10px;
	color: #ffeab2;
}
.goldMed {
	font-size: 11px;
	color: #ffeab2;
}
/*------- not --------*/
.message {
	FONT-WEIGHT: bold; FONT-SIZE: 10pt; COLOR: #131f34;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-ALIGN: center;
}
